negawsklov17 wrote:
well, i've been filling up the tank many times as i'm sure we all have, and on my FUEL INJECTED STOCK MOTOR i get 160 miles per tank maximum. it's really the pits, which is one of the reasons i'm planning to switch it over to dual 34 dell's with the help of my father.



and no you can't have my FI parts, sorry


Also check your system voltage after the voltage regulator. The FI system is sensitive to input voltage and if your regulator is going to heck and not providing enough voltage, the system will run rich and your mileage will suffer.

You should be able to go low to mid 20s city driving with the stock FI. Switching to dual carbs probably won't improve your mileage.
